Claims
- 1. A system for examination of a substance which emits light at a wavelength greater than a wavelength of light emitted from the light source when the substance is excited by the wavelength of light emitted from the light source, the light source comprising:
a light source comprising:
a housing having a light outlet; and a low voltage lamp oriented to emit light through the light outlet, the light source emitting an excitation wavelengths of light; and a filter lens through which emission of light from a substance when the substance is excited by excitation wavelength of light, the filter lens including a primary filter and a trim filter through which the emission wavelength can be detected and the excitation wavelengths of light is substantially blocked.
- 2. The system of claim 1, wherein the trim filter substantially blocks transmission of wavelengths that compete with detection of the emission wavelength from the dye.
- 3. The system of claim 1, wherein the trim filter substantially blocks a set of wavelengths different from the wavelengths blocked by the primary filter.
- 4. The system of claim 1, wherein the light source emits light of wavelengths up to 700 nm.
- 5. The system of claim 1, wherein the primary filter substantially blocks light in the range of 720 to 850 nm.
- 6. The system of claim 1, wherein the trim filter substantially blocks light from 650 to 850 nm.
- 7. The system of claim 1, wherein the primary filter includes a rose colored dye.
- 8. The system of claim 7, wherein the trim filter includes a blue colored dye.
- 9. The system of claim 1, wherein the low voltage lamp includes a light emitting diode.
- 10. The system of claim 1, wherein the lamp is powered by a battery.
- 11. The system of claim 1, wherein the filter lens is a portion of eyewear.
- 12. A method of testing a system containing a substance capable of emitting an emission wavelength of light after being excited by an excitation wavelength of light, the method comprising:
providing an excitation wavelength of light from a light source to a test site; and detecting transmission of light through a filter lens including a primary filter and a trim filter through which the emission wavelength can be detected and the excitation wavelengths of light is substantially blocked.
- 13. The method of claim 12, wherein the trim filter substantially blocks transmission of wavelengths that compete with detection of the emission wavelength from the dye.
- 14. The method of claim 12, wherein the trim filter blocks a set of wavelengths different from the wavelengths blocked by the primary filter.
- 15. The method of claim 12, wherein the light source emits light of wavelengths up to 700 nm.
- 16. The method of claim 12, wherein the primary filter blocks light in the range of 720 to 850 nm.
- 17. The method of claim 12, wherein the trim filter blocks light from 650 to 850 nm.
- 18. The method of claim 12, wherein the primary filter includes a rose colored dye.
- 19. The method of claim 18, wherein the trim filter includes a blue colored dye.
- 20. The method of claim 12, wherein the low voltage lamp includes a light emitting diode.
